HOUSE BILL 89
AN ACT requiring the attorney general to join the lawsuit challenging the Patient Protection and Affordable Care Act.
SPONSORS: Rep. Weyler, Rock 8; Rep. Reagan, Rock 1; Rep. Marshall Quandt, Rock 13; Rep. Ulery, Hills 27; Rep. Bettencourt, Rock 4; Sen. Barnes, Jr., Dist 17
COMMITTEE: State-Federal Relations and Veterans Affairs
This bill requires the attorney general to join the state of New Hampshire as a plaintiff in the lawsuit pending in federal court captioned State of Florida et al. v. United States Department of Health and Human Services et al.

STATE OF NEW HAMPSHIRE
In the Year of Our Lord Two Thousand Eleven
AN ACT requiring the attorney general to join the lawsuit challenging the Patient Protection and Affordable Care Act.
Be it Enacted by the Senate and House of Representatives in General Court convened:
1 Lawsuit Challenging the Federal Patient Protection and Affordable Care Act. The attorney general shall, no later than July 1, 2011, move to join the state of New Hampshire as a plaintiff in the lawsuit pending in federal court captioned State of Florida et al. v. United States Department of Health and Human Services et al.
2 Effective Date. This act shall take effect upon its passage.
